Transaction 761617c24b3241f379d0b99c0247207c774bc951e6539c32ca93723de18202c4

21 Input
2 Outputs
  • 761617c24b3241f379d0b99c0247207c774bc951e6539c32ca93723de18202c4:0
  • value  8144
    address  bc1qu647ly5f0vapcgdelaha3jz55p9ajlsmxxqszc
  • 761617c24b3241f379d0b99c0247207c774bc951e6539c32ca93723de18202c4:1
  • value  196583
    address  3JfoTMbLyGeM5MkqYRwt64T5m7UjdAYXrj